Differential Association Theory

A sociological theory that attributes the development of criminal behavior to interaction with others who already engage in crime.

Deviance

Behaviors or actions that violate social norms, including formally-enacted rules as well as informal understandings of acceptable conduct.

Crime

Activities that violate the laws of a society and are punishable by authorities.
